Traction Circuit Testing − Piston Pump/Hydrostat (P3) Flow and
Relief Pressure Test (continued)
Hydraulic System: Testing
Before jacking up the machine, review and follow
Instructions (page
1–7).
4. Raise off the floor and support both front wheels and the rear wheel.
g344857
1.
Lower hydraulic fitting
5. Disconnect hose from the lower hydraulic fitting on the engine side of the
hydrostat
(Figure
45).
6. Install the tester in series with the pump and the disconnected hose. Make
sure the tester flow control valve is fully open.
7. Start the engine. Move throttle to full speed (2650 ±50 RPM).
8. Make sure that the hydraulic fluid is at normal operating temperature by
operating the machine for approximately 10 minutes. Make sure the hydraulic
tank is full.
9. Verify with a phototach that the pump speed is approximately 3100 RPM.
10. Sit in the operator's seat, release the parking brake, and set the
Mow/Transport slide to the transport position.
Use extreme caution when performing hydrostat flow tests. The
traction unit wheels will be rotating during the test.
11. Verify the pump flow at No Load as follows:
A. Slowly depress forward traction pedal to full forward position.
B. Record tester pressure and flow readings. Unrestricted pump output
should be approximately 69 LPM (18 GPM) at 44.8 Bar (650 PSI).
12. Verify pump flow Under Load as follows:
A. Slowly depress forward traction pedal to full forward position.
